Description

The image depicts the Daniel Webster Family Home, also known as Elms Farm, located in Franklin, New Hampshire. The building is a large, multi-story house featuring several chimneys, shutters on the windows, and a prominent covered porch with columns. It is surrounded by a well-maintained lawn and tall trees, with a path leading to the entrance.
